What if you’d like 8X magnification, however not the dimensions and weight of 8×42 binoculars? That is the place 8×32, 8×30, and even 7×32 in some instances, are available in. They provide the identical magnification, however a narrower subject of view—it may be harder to trace small objects like a warbler flitting via foliage, however with a bit apply it isn’t too onerous to handle. For climbing and touring mild, this dimension is an effective compromise. Compact binoculars usually contain a major compromise in picture high quality. Relying in your use case, the burden financial savings could also be well worth the trade-off, however basically, I counsel that birders and hunters keep on with 32-mm or bigger binoculars. Sure, you possibly can chook with 8x25s, nevertheless it’s usually irritating.

If you assume stargazing you in all probability assume telescopes, however binoculars can work too, particularly bigger, greater magnification fashions like these Celestron Skymasters. The very first thing to know is that these are enormous, more often than not you will wish to use them with a tripod, which isn’t included within the worth (they do embrace an adapter, which I used to place them on a photograph tripod, which labored tremendous). The Porro prism design (see beneath), with 15x magnification and 70mm goal lenses make these are good and shiny, excellent for getting good views of the moon. In addition they work for bigger clusters and nebulae. They do work for birding as nicely, however its extra like utilizing a recognizing scope. They’re good for digiscoping although in case you’re viewing one thing cheap stationary, like water birds.
As with all Celestron binos there is a good huge, easy focusing knob, and so they even have lengthy eye reduction which makes them simple to make use of with glasses. There’s a good bit chromatic aberration, particularly with shiny stars or the moon, however I did not discover it distracting. In truth, for the worth, these present surprisingly nice views.

Picture-stabilized binoculars use electronics to easy out your view much like what motion cams do to eliminate jittery video. There are fairly a couple of fashions on the market, and we’re nonetheless testing, however listed below are few which have stood out from the pack to this point.
Picture-stabilized binoculars are typically costly, however Canon has fairly a couple of funds fashions value contemplating. They’re easy to make use of. You simply faucet the button on high for 5 minutes of stabilization, or faucet once more to show it off sooner. The tech detects your motion and adjusts for it optically, in actual time. The Canon 8×20 IS, its smallest, are doubly pocket-friendly: They’re surprisingly inexpensive and slot in a big pocket. At 15-ounce plus battery, they gained’t weigh you down.The 8X magnification is nice for wildlife and sports activities, as is the 10X magnification of the one barely bigger Canon 10×20 IS. The 6.6-degree subject of view is slender however extensive sufficient for many conditions.
The stabilization is game-changing. I by no means actually observed the shake earlier than, then I pressed the button and noticed the distinction: It’s crisp, like a photograph, but shifting. Leaves rustle, smoke rises. It’s virtually like utilizing a tripod. They’re nice for shake-free birdwatching, climbing, and common snooping. And at night time they’re good for moon-gazing, with crisp element so regular that it trumps optically superior fashions. —Caramel Quin

If you happen to actually wish to zoom in on the world, recognizing scopes are the best way to go. They’ve a steeper studying curve than binoculars. It may be very difficult to trace small lively birds, however while you get one thing within the viewing lens of Pentax’s new PF-85EDA Recognizing Scope, the view is gorgeous. The 85-mm goal lens is shiny and sharp with virtually no chromatic aberrations. I examined the package with the 8-24 mm eyepiece, however the eyepiece slot will settle for most XF collection eyepieces and XW collection, that are optimized for astronomical commentary.
The 45-degree bend within the scope makes it comfy to make use of sitting or standing. That mentioned, in case you’re in search of a light-weight scope, look elsewhere; this factor is giant and heavy. That mentioned, it’s comparatively compact, and the efficiency is excellent for the worth. Whereas I have never examined many others, the PF-85EDA is a pleasant midrange choice that is light-years higher than cheaper fashions however will not set you again $3,000 or extra like high-end recognizing scopes.
